Another reason this grip is so good for osu is that it helps to isolate wrist movement and finger movement. One of the biggest causes for inconcistency in osu for me at least was that I incorporated some finger movement into horizontal aim with my old grip. For greatest aim consistency, your fingers should only be used for vertical movement while your wrist should only be used for horizontal movement. Since wrist movement is the weakest it makes horizontal jumps difficult which is why most top players have a distorted area favoring higher sensitivity for horizontal movement and lower sensitivity for vertical movement.
